The utility model discloses an infusion tube heating device with a fixer, which comprises an infusion tube, the upper end of the infusion tube is connected with a medicine bottle fixed on a bracket, a heating device is arranged on the infusion tube, and the heating device is embracing and fixed on the infusion tube, wherein the bracket A fixer is provided on the top, and the fixer includes a first fixing hole and a second fixing hole. A first friction ring is pasted on the hole wall of the first fixing hole. The bracket passes through the first fixing hole, and the first friction ring Friction fit with the bracket to fix the fixer on the bracket, an insertion channel is formed on the side of the second fixing hole, a second friction ring is attached to the inner wall of the second fixing hole, the infusion tube is squeezed into the second fixing hole from the insertion channel and Frictionally fit with the second friction ring body to fix the infusion tube with the holder, and the heating device is placed on the section of the infusion tube at the lower side of the holder. The utility model has the advantages of being able to control the height of the infusion tube heating device, simple in structure and convenient to use.

背景技术 Background technique
目前,在临床治疗中,输液反应是常见的一种并发症,其原因之一就是在秋冬季或者周围环境温度较低的情况下,患者通过输液管输入的液体温度过低,有些药物遇冷易产生结晶,如甘露醇。低于人体体温的调节中枢而出现的并发症,如寒战、发热、血管痉挛等。解决方法就是在输液管上增设加热装置,通过对输液管内流过的药液加热使药液接近体温,防止不良反应。然而,由于输液管比较长,加热装置容易垂至较低的位置,易烫伤患者。 At present, in clinical treatment, infusion reaction is a common complication. One of the reasons is that in autumn and winter or when the ambient temperature is low, the temperature of the liquid infused by the patient through the infusion tube is too low. Prone to crystallization, such as mannitol. Complications arising from lower body temperature regulation centers, such as chills, fever, and vasospasm. The solution is to add a heating device on the infusion tube to heat the medicinal liquid flowing through the infusion tube to make the medicinal liquid close to body temperature and prevent adverse reactions. However, because the infusion tube is relatively long, the heating device is easy to hang down to a lower position, which is easy to scald the patient.

与现有技术相比,本实用新型的具有固定器的输液管加热装置,在加热装置的上部位置安装固定器,将输液管的高度锁住,防止加热装置落到病床上或者病人手边在病人不注意时烫伤病人。本实用新型的固定器分为两部分,每一部分都设有孔,孔内设置摩擦环,其中一个固定孔用于将固定器固定在支架上,这个孔没有插入通道,是预先留在支架上的,由于这个固定孔内的摩擦环内径要小于支架杆的外径,因此固定器能通过支架与摩擦环的摩擦力固定在支架上。当固定器需要进行高度调节时,护士用力将固定器竖向移动,当外力大于支架与摩擦环的摩擦力时,固定器就能在支架上滑动,从而达到调节固定器高度的目的。同理,另外一个摩擦环的内径略小于输液管的外径,一般情况下,输液管与固定器固定,当需要调节加热装置高度时,用手拉动输液管,使外力大于输液管与固定器的摩擦力,进而调节输液管上的加热装置高度。当调好加热装置高度后,停止拉动输液管,使输液管与固定器再次固定,即可将加热装置高度固定。 Compared with the prior art, the infusion tube heating device with the fixer of the utility model installs the fixer at the upper position of the heating device to lock the height of the infusion tube to prevent the heating device from falling on the hospital bed or at the patient's hand. Burn patient if not careful. The fixer of the present utility model is divided into two parts, each part is provided with a hole, and a friction ring is set in the hole, one of the fixing holes is used to fix the fixer on the bracket, this hole is not inserted into the channel, it is left on the bracket in advance Yes, since the inner diameter of the friction ring in the fixing hole is smaller than the outer diameter of the bracket rod, the fixer can be fixed on the bracket through the friction force between the bracket and the friction ring. When the holder needs to be adjusted in height, the nurse moves the holder vertically. When the external force is greater than the friction between the bracket and the friction ring, the holder can slide on the bracket, thereby achieving the purpose of adjusting the height of the holder. Similarly, the inner diameter of the other friction ring is slightly smaller than the outer diameter of the infusion tube. Generally, the infusion tube is fixed with the holder. When it is necessary to adjust the height of the heating device, pull the infusion tube by hand so that the external force is greater than the infusion tube and the holder. friction, and then adjust the height of the heating device on the infusion tube. After the height of the heating device is adjusted, stop pulling the infusion tube to fix the infusion tube and the fixer again, and then the height of the heating device can be fixed.
